Day 2 at the Classic

A sunny day was a real treat for anglers fishing the 2nd day of the tournament. The N/NW wind didn’t seem to worry anglers too much other than the dirty water  this teamed with big tides meant that it was a key strategy to find the clear water to find the fish. The best performing teams favored the shallower areas to find good numbers with Plastics Paranoia  boating a 90cm Gem which was the best fish of the day. The deep areas didn’t seem to fish as well and besides a couple of rippers caught by a bait fisho the largest I saw netted was in the 70’s.

The southern end of the Gold Coast seems to be fishy well for tournament Senior leader Shane ‘piggy’ Gartner who has maintained the lead on day 2. Likewise Team Dead Fishy has maintained and even stretched their lead on day 2 With all 3 anglers performing well. Dead Fishy didn’t have a lot of pre-fishing time on the water but this has not hurt them at all.  Hot on their heels is Team Sands brothers George ‘The dugong’ and Danny along with their Uncle Kevin scored great numbers of fish using a combination of casting and trolling the team made a charge on day 2.
